alicebanks9379 created a new article
1 w

Mastering Online Slots | #casino Game

Mastering Online Slots

Understanding Online Slots
Online slots are digital variations of conventional slot machines found in casinos. They come in numerous themes, designs, and complexities, appealing to a broad audience.